The Programme is designed to provide in-depth knowledge on the composition, nutritional quality, sensory properties, and health effects of food. Special attention is paid to the influence of environment, genetic factors, and processing at molecular level.
Application of food metabolomics and modern biotechnological methods in food research and food development is an important part of the curriculum. The curriculum also covers various aspects of healthy foods, food safety, and European food legislation as well as practical guidance and orientation in career development.
